Marine plywood is a high-quality material made from Douglas fir or western larch that has not undergone chemical treatment. It is known for its strength and is commonly utilized in the construction of boats, docks, and related components. This type of plywood is particularly suitable for environments where prolonged exposure to moisture is expected.

The main applications of marine plywood can be categorized into marine and non-marine applications. Due to its exceptional structural properties and resistance to water, marine plywood is widely used in marine applications. Its construction ensures minimal gaps between plies, even after sawing and treatment with heat and pressure. Marine plywood finds use in various marine applications, including decks, docks, boats, and more. In non-marine applications, it is employed for crafting outdoor patio furniture or wooden structures, especially in regions with moist climate conditions.

The marine plywood market size has grown strongly in recent years. It will grow from $11.82 billion in 2023 to $13 billion in 2024 at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 10.0%. The expansion observed in the historical period can be attributed to several factors, including growth in the shipbuilding industry, development of marine infrastructure, construction of waterfront properties, adherence to marine safety regulations, the popularity of recreational boating, and various architectural applications. These factors collectively contributed to the increased demand and utilization of marine plywood during this period.

The marine plywood market size is expected to see rapid growth in the next few years. It will grow to $19.46 billion in 2028 at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 10.6%. The projected growth in the forecast period can be attributed to factors such as the increasing demand for renewable energy, the growth in tourism, rising demand for luxury yachts, a focus on climate resilience, and the continued expansion of global shipping and trade. Noteworthy trends expected in this period include the adoption of eco-friendly materials, the development of innovative plywood technologies, the emphasis on coastal protection, the integration of digital transformation in marine applications, and the utilization of innovative bonding agents in plywood manufacturing.

The surge in demand for high-speed and luxurious recreational boats stands out as a key driver fueling the growth of the marine plywood market. The global marine tourism sector has experienced significant growth, with coastal and marine tourism projected to become the largest value-adding segment of the ocean economy by 2030, contributing to over 26% of the global ocean economy. This growth has led to an increased demand for marine plywood in various applications such as stringers, flooring, transoms, boat cabinetry, walls, and seating, significantly impacting the marine plywood market.

The upward trajectory of the construction industry is poised to further propel the marine plywood market. With a focus on planning, designing, building, and maintaining structures and infrastructure, the construction sector has witnessed substantial growth. Marine plywood, valued for its durability and resistance to moisture-related damage, finds extensive use in residential construction, particularly in regions prone to high humidity and wet conditions. An annual increase of 12.7% in the construction sector has been reported, emphasizing the industry's robust growth. The use of marine plywood in construction applications is expected to continue driving the marine plywood market.

A notable trend in the marine plywood market is the advancement of marine plywood in roofing and doors. Recognized for its performance in humid and wet conditions, marine plywood contributes to enhanced durability and structural strength in construction. Its characteristics include improved structural strength, lightweight nature, and excellent resistance to warping, bending, and delamination. This trend is reflected in the increasing utilization of marine plywood in building rooftops and doors in residential spaces, showcasing its resilience in challenging environmental conditions.

Major companies in the marine plywood market are embracing sustainability by introducing new products such as sustainably sourced plywood. Sustainably sourced plywood is manufactured using environmentally responsible and ethical practices across the entire supply chain. Plyco, an Australia-based provider of timber-based panel products, launched a sustainably sourced plywood range, featuring popular options like birch plywood, European poplar plywood, and hoop pine plywood. The Hoop Pine Plywood, known for high-quality finishing, is carefully selected from sustainably managed plantations, reflecting Plyco's commitment to environmentally friendly practices.

In July 2022, Boise Cascade, a US-based wood products manufacturing company, acquired Coastal Plywood Company for $512 million. This strategic move enhances Boise Cascade's veneer capacity, contributing to better service for its customer base. The acquisition aligns with Boise Cascade's plans to invest $50 million in its Southeast operations over three years, bolstering engineered wood products (EWP) production capacity. Coastal Plywood Company, a US-based wood products manufacturer, represents a valuable addition to Boise Cascade's portfolio, reinforcing its position in the wood products market.
